I seem to have a graphical problem that doesn't want to be fixed too easily. Basically, any city that I enter - particularly Windurst - will look normal for roughly twenty minutes before going "gray." By which I mean everything except shrubs, trees, NPCs, and PCs melds into a colorless void type thing. The objects are still there; I can still enter doors, target things, and so on and so forth, but I can't see anything then just a blank screen (with the aforementioned anomalies). Outdoors, this isn't a problem. Although West Ronfaurre and Sarutabaruta are the only outdoor areas I've been to yet, they seem to work fine. As soon as I zone into a city, though, or shortly thereafter, the game becomes pretty much unplayable. Trying to run around Windurst Waters without actually being able to, um, see anything is a moderately frustrating experience.
So far as I can tell, it isn't my hardware causing the problem...I meet or exceed all the recommended specs (Pentium 4 2.26 ghz, Geforce FX 5900 Ultra, 512 DDR, etc.), so...I don't know, heh. I've tried fiddling around with the configuration - bump mapping on, bump mapping off, screwing around with the resolutions, the works - but either I'm missing something or it just doesn't do anything.
So....anyone know what's up? The FAQ doesn't seem to mention anything even remotely related, and search doesn't pick up anything. I emailed customer service, but having jazzed with SoE and Verant for far too long, I guess I have a kicked puppy mindset about the whole thing.
